# MDItemCreate(_:_:)

Creates an MDItem object for a file at the specified path.

## Declaration

```swift
func MDItemCreate(_ allocator: CFAllocator!, _ path: CFString!) -> MDItem!
```

## Parameters

- `allocator`: The CFAllocator object to be used to allocate memory for the new object. Pass NULL or kCFAllocatorDefault to use the current default allocator.
- `path`: A path to the file from which to create the MDItem. The path must exist.

## Return Value

Return Value An MDItem object or NULL if there was a problem creating the object.

## Discussion

Discussion Returns a metadata item for the given URL. Special Considerations In macOS 10.5 and later MDItemRefs may or may not be uniqued. You should always use CFEqual for comparison.  Prior to OS X v 10.5 items were guaranteed to be unique and == could or CFEqual could be used for the comparison.
